Hermit, Co vs Minneapolis, Minnesota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Hermit, Co, Usa and Minneapolis, Minnesota, Usa is approximately 1,378 km or 856 mi.
  • To reach Hermit, Co in this distance one would set out from Minneapolis, Minnesota bearing 241.1° or WS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Hermit, Co bearing 231.9° or SW .
  • Hermit, Co has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Minneapolis, Minnesota has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
  • Hermit, Co is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Minneapolis, Minnesota is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 6.1 °C (11°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.7 °C (15.7°F) less in Hermit, Co.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 305.4 mm (12 in) less which is equivalent to 305.4 l/m² (7.5 US gal/ft²) or 3,054,000 l/ha (326,493 US gal/ac) less. About 4/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6.9° higher in Hermit, Co than in Minneapolis, Minnesota.
